Recent Price Action
Genesis Land Development Corp. (GDC.TO) closed at C$3.61 on Thursday, marking a decrease of 0.56% for the day. Over the past week, however, the stock has seen an increase of 2.62%. Year-to-date, the stock has appreciated by 8.62%, indicating a generally positive trend despite the minor setback this week.
Advertisement
Company News and Financial Results
Recently, Genesis Land Development Corp. announced its Q1 2026 financial results, reporting revenues of $51.5 million and net earnings of $0.8 million. The company also declared a special dividend of $0.12 per share, reflecting its commitment to returning value to shareholders. Additionally, the company reported a revenue increase for the year ended December 31, 2025, with total revenues of $381.2 million, up from $361.1 million in 2024.
Technical Picture
In terms of technical analysis, Genesis Land Development Corp. is currently trading above its 50-day moving average of C$3.40 and its 200-day moving average of C$3.35, suggesting a bullish trend. The stock has a beta of 0.23, indicating lower volatility compared to the broader market. The 52-week range for GDC.TO is between C$2.84 and C$3.61, showing that the stock has reached the upper end of its range.
